Excel日期倒算怎么做?如何快速实现日期倒退?
作者:佚名|分类:EXCEL|浏览:134|发布时间:2025-04-04 07:21:36
Excel日期倒算怎么做?如何快速实现日期倒退?
在Excel中,进行日期的倒算或者日期的倒退是一个常见的操作,特别是在财务、项目管理或者数据分析等领域。以下是一篇详细的文章,将指导你如何使用Excel的功能来快速实现日期的倒退。
引言
日期倒算,即在现有的日期基础上减去一定的时间单位(如天、月、年)来得到新的日期。Excel提供了多种方法来实现这一功能,包括使用内置函数、公式以及快捷键等。
方法一:使用内置函数
Excel中有几个内置函数可以用来进行日期的倒算,以下是一些常用的函数:
1. DATEADD 函数
DATEADD 函数可以用来在指定的日期上加上或减去特定的时间单位。
```excel
=DATEADD("d", -30, 当前日期) 从当前日期减去30天
```
2. EOMONTH 函数
EOMONTH 函数可以用来得到指定日期所在月份的最后一天。
```excel
=EOMONTH(当前日期, -1) 从当前日期减去一个月,得到上个月的最后一天
```
3. TODAY 函数
TODAY 函数可以用来获取当前日期,配合其他函数使用可以实现日期的倒退。
```excel
=TODAY() 7 获取当前日期减去7天的日期
```
方法二:使用公式
除了使用函数,你还可以通过编写公式来实现日期的倒算。
1. 直接减法
你可以直接在单元格中使用减法来倒算日期。
```excel
=当前日期 30 从当前日期减去30天
```
2. 使用YEAR、MONTH、DAY 函数
通过YEAR、MONTH、DAY函数,你可以分别获取年份、月份和日期,然后进行计算。
```excel
=DATE(YEAR(当前日期)-1, MONTH(当前日期), DAY(当前日期)) 从当前日期减去一年
```
方法三:使用快捷键
如果你只是需要简单地减去几天,可以使用Excel的快捷键来快速实现。
1. 减去天数
在包含日期的单元格上,直接输入负数,然后按回车键。
```excel
=当前日期 5 从当前日期减去5天
```
方法四:使用条件格式
如果你需要根据日期的变化来突出显示某些日期,可以使用条件格式。
1. 设置条件格式
选择包含日期的单元格区域,然后点击“开始”选项卡中的“条件格式”。
```excel
=TODAY() 7 设置条件格式,突出显示当前日期减去7天的日期
```
相关问答
1. 如何在Excel中减去一个月的日期?
使用EOMONTH函数,例如:`=EOMONTH(当前日期, -1)`。
2. 如何在Excel中减去一年的日期?
使用YEAR、MONTH、DAY函数,例如:`=DATE(YEAR(当前日期)-1, MONTH(当前日期), DAY(当前日期))`。
3. 如何在Excel中快速减去一个星期?
使用TODAY函数和减法,例如:`=TODAY() 7`。
4. 如何在Excel中减去特定数量的天数?
使用DATEADD函数,例如:`=DATEADD("d", -30, 当前日期)`。
5. 如何在Excel中设置条件格式,突出显示特定日期?
选择单元格区域,点击“开始”选项卡中的“条件格式”,然后选择合适的条件格式规则。
通过以上方法,你可以在Excel中轻松实现日期的倒算和日期的倒退。这些技巧不仅能够提高你的工作效率,还能帮助你更好地处理和分析数据。